Friend of Trace – Paul CoughlinPaul Coughlin is an expert witness regarding bullying and the law, and the founder and president of the anti-bullying program The Protectors. He has appeared in many media outlets. Paul is a best-selling author of eight books, including the freedom-from-bullying parent and teacher resource Raising Bully-Proof Kids, as well as a former newspaper editor. He works with numerous professional organizations to diminish bullying. His anti-bullying curriculum is used throughout North America as well as in South Africa, Uganda, Australia, New Zealand and Brazil among other countries.

Paul is a boys varsity soccer coach, where he was voted Coach of the Year twice. Paul has previously served as a member of the Board of Trustees for St. Mary’s School in Medford, Oregon.
He is also a popular men’s conference speaker who has inspired thousands across North America as well as in Wales and England.

Freeing Us from BullyingTrace Embry and Michelle Hill talk with friend Paul Coughlin. They discuss the issue of bullying with a focus on how parents can help their children navigate this problem. They share the importance of recognizing that anyone can be a bully, including one’s own child, and the need for a plan of action if this is the case. The role of the internet is also highlighted and how it exacerbates bullying as it allows for constant harassment.

Paul Coughlin, author of the book “Freeing Us from Bullying,” emphasizes the importance of teaching children to stand up against bullying, and the dangers of allowing them to become victims. He also differentiates between teasing and bullying, and explains why some people become bullies. The discussion also touches on the misinterpretation of biblical teachings, such as “turning the other cheek,” in the context of bullying.

How to Help Your Child Feel Loved Trace Embry, Michelle Hill and our friend Dr. Gary Chapman, author of The Five Love Languages of Children, discuss how parents can foster emotional wellbeing in their children by understanding their love languages. He explains that each child has a primary love language, which could be physical touch, words of affirmation, acts of service, receiving gifts, or quality time.

Parents can identify their child’s love language by observing their behavior, listening to their complaints, and noting their requests. Dr. Chapman emphasizes that while all love languages are important, speaking the child’s primary love language is crucial for them to feel loved. He also suggests that discipline should be wrapped in the child’s love language to ensure fairness and understanding.
